I'm trying to set up a DNS server that does forwarding and I'm not having much
luck.  I'm using bind 8.2.3 on a Solaris 7 box (e.g., 10.2.254.118)  I have
added the following entry into the named.conf file (within the "options"
section):

forwarders {128.171.50.10; };
forward-only;

On, 10.2.254.118, I start up a snoop session listening for 128.171.50.10
packets.  When, I use nslookup, I do not see any packets, and nslookup
fails on resolving:

% nslookup www.yahoo.com
Server:  dns03.####.com
Address:  10.2.254.118

*** dns03sea.corp.cheaptickets.com can't find www.yahoo.com: Server failed
%

so I suspect that it's not even sending a query to 128.171.50.10

Am I misusing the forwarders entry?
